Role Purpose The Carpenter is responsible for carrying out skilled carpentry work across construction, repair, maintenance, and installation projects. The role supports the company’s service delivery by ensuring work is completed safely, accurately, on time, and in line with project requirements, building standards, and client expectations. Key Responsibilities Read and interpret plans, drawings, specifications, and work instructions. Measure, cut, shape, assemble, and install timber and other building materials. Construct, install, and repair wall frames, roof structures, flooring, doors, windows, and fittings. Build and install formwork, frameworks, partitions, and internal structures. Select suitable materials, tools, and equipment for each task. Carry out repairs, maintenance, and modifications to existing structures. Ensure all carpentry work meets quality, safety, and project requirements. Follow Australian building codes, WHS requirements, and site procedures. Coordinate with supervisors, tradespeople, suppliers, and clients as required. Maintain tools, equipment, materials, and work areas in safe condition. Identify defects, hazards, delays, and material issues promptly. Keep basic job records, measurements, material usage, and progress updates. Support efficient work practices to reduce waste, rework, and delays. Assist with site preparation, clean-up, and safe material handling. Contribute to a professional, safe, and team-focused workplace. What We Are Looking For Minimum one (1) year of relevant carpentry or construction experience. Relevant qualification in carpentry, construction, building, or a related trade field. Strong skills in measuring, cutting, framing, fixing, and installation. Sound knowledge of WHS practices and safe construction site procedures. Ability to read plans, use hand tools, power tools, and carpentry equipment.
